Output 58b3132a30fc090da47cbd9ee69491cdc2064df982242f915d67f463c0a75277:9

value
12755794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9aff19597015d8e23755d450c9533044ceb6df OP_EQUAL
address
MR18GeTuFrTnCfUQZSGdkKPWzpiGXhmScP
transaction
58b3132a30fc090da47cbd9ee69491cdc2064df982242f915d67f463c0a75277
spent
true